General Purpose Detergent

NSN: 7930-01-408-2905 | Model: 09853340

A cleaner of nonspecific chemicals compounded for the general removal of grime, dirt, and/or grease, oil, rust preventive compounds, and the like. It contains no wax to impart a polished finish and no abrasive materials. Do not use if a more specific name can be found in cataloging handbook h6, section a. Excludes soap (as modified). See also cleaning compound (as modified); and wetting agent.

Hazards

Routes of entry: inhalation: yes skin: no ingestion: yes
reports of carcinogenicity: ntp: no iarc: no osha: no
health hazards acute and chronic: defats skin. Irritates eyes. Prolonged
eye contact may cause damage.

medical cond aggravated by exposure: sensitive skin & eyes.

First Aid

First aid: inhalation: remove to fresh air. Eyes: flush thoroughly
w/fresh water. If irritation persists get medical aid. Skin: flush
w/fresh water, wash w/soap & water. Remove contaminated
clothes/shoes. Ingest ion: give water. Do not induce vomiting. Get
medical aid. Never give anything by mouth to an unconscious person.

Chemical Properties

Boiling pt: b.P. Text: 212f,100c
vapor pres: 17.5
vapor density: na
spec gravity: 1.020
evaporation rate & reference: 1.02 (buac=1)
solubility in water: 100%
appearance and odor: clear, green liquid, lemon odor
percent volatiles by volume: 90.0

Reactivity

Stability indicator/materials to avoid: yes
petroleum solvents, concentrated acids, oxidizing agents.

hazardous decomposition products: co, so2 w/incomplete combustion.
